At least once in every blogger’s life there comes a time when you just can’t keep squeezing your brain to get a new, fresh idea out of it for your blog. It just can’t be helped. You find yourself trying to write something but all you see is a huge lack of creativity.
Why does this happen? There are a couple of reasons that might help you find the answer to this question:
- You’re posting too frequently: When building your blog up, it is important to post in a daily basis in order to fill it with good content and fast. However, once you’ve reached a certain amount of visitors you should take a break. Post quality stuff every 2-3 days or so.
- Your niche’s range is too limited: If your blog is about australian sharks or phpBB v.1.0 mods (modifications), one day you’ll find out that you have already posted everything you know about that. Try to expand your niche’s range into a more wider, general one (but remember: stay always on topic!)
- You’re on the wrong niche: Yes. You might be writing about stuff you don’t really know/care that much. You should consider changing your niche into something you really, really like. If this is your case, perhaps you have missed my post about Succesful Blogging tips.
Once you have found the answer there’s only one thing you can do: lay back and think about it. Here’s a list of some suggestions of what you can do during your muse hunting journey:
- Read someone else’s blog (like mine ;)): this is a powerful source of inspiration. Read what others on your same niche have to say about it. Maybe you’ll find some unexplored areas or fresh stuff you never thought about before.
- Get disconnected: maybe you’re spending too much time online. Go out, have a date, visit museums, feed the birds, kick a trash can and run away, get laid (this one is the best inspirational activity hehe). Your brain will feel revitalized and you’ll get tons of new ideas to write about.
- Experience your niche: if you’re writing about australian sharks, you might want to go and take a dive with them (and please remember to come back in one piece!). Living your passion will give you a wide vision of it and the muse will be with you again.
Hope that helps you find the way back to the track
